Ghanaian singer, songwriter and producer KiDi released his latest studio album, Where Do We Go From Here, on August 27, 2026. The 15-track project runs for approximately 39 minutes and marks another major chapter in KiDi’s career. The album was released through his Black Boy Joy imprint under an exclusive global licence to Encore Recordings. 

The title Where Do We Go From Here suggests a project built around questions of direction, relationships, personal growth and the different stages of life. The album combines KiDi’s melodic songwriting with contemporary Ghanaian Afrobeats and highlife influences.

The album opens with “Crazy World”, followed by “Special Lovin” and “See Thru.” These opening records establish KiDi as the sole performer before the first major collaboration arrives on the fourth track.

“IDK” features Ghanaian rap heavyweight Sarkodie. The collaboration brings KiDi’s melodic approach together with Sarkodie’s rap delivery and is one of the album’s prominent guest appearances. 

The fifth track, “Signature,” features Lasmid. The song continues the album’s run of collaborations before KiDi returns to a solo performance on “Agreement.”

Track seven, “Lonely,” features AratheJay, while “Headache” follows as another solo KiDi record. The ninth song, “Crucified,” features Kwesi Arthur, giving the album another collaboration between two prominent Ghanaian artists. 

The second half of the album includes “Lord Knows,” “Babylon,” “2 Much Sugar” and “Red Dress.” KiDi handles these records without featured artists, keeping the focus on his vocals, songwriting and production choices.

The final two songs are “Confession” and “Dreams.” With “Dreams” closing the project, KiDi brings the 15-track album to an end after approximately 39 minutes of music. 

One of the notable characteristics of Where Do We Go From Here is its balance between solo performances and collaborations. KiDi remains the main voice across the project, while Sarkodie, Lasmid, AratheJay and Kwesi Arthur each contribute to selected tracks.

The album also represents KiDi’s return with a full-length studio project after several years. Coverage of the release identifies it as his third studio album and his first full-length project in five years. 

Across its 15 songs, Where Do We Go From Here explores a mixture of romantic themes, emotional experiences, ambition, uncertainty and personal reflection. The different song titles create a broad picture of KiDi’s songwriting, ranging from “Special Lovin” and “Red Dress” to more reflective titles such as “Lonely,” “Confession,” “Agreement” and “Dreams.”

The production credits also show contributions from producers including M.O.G. Beatz, Jae5, GuiltyBeatz, DJ Breezy, LiquidBeatz, Tough and others, while KiDi himself is credited as a producer on some of the songs. 

With its combination of Afrobeats, highlife influences, melodic songwriting and Ghanaian rap collaborations, KiDi – Where Do We Go From Here adds a new full-length chapter to KiDi’s discography.

From “Crazy World” through “Dreams,” the album gives listeners 15 songs that showcase KiDi’s contemporary sound while bringing together several notable Ghanaian artists.
